On his third Criss Cross leader date, Mike Moreno convenes drummer Kendrick Scott, who played on his fellow Houstonian's prior Criss Cross outings (Third Wish and First In Mind) and bassist Doug Weiss, who played on Third Wish. They frame the 39-year-old guitarist's sui generis tonal on a program culled from the corpuses of a multigenerational cohort of heroes jazz songs by Charlie Parker(InchPerhaps'), Wayne Shorter (InchThe Big PushInch), Joe Henderson (InchSerenityInch) and Mulgrew Miller (InchFor Those Who DoInch); Songbook gems by Michel Legrand InchYou Must Believe In SpringInch), Johnny Mandel (InchA Time For LoveInch) and Vernon Duke (InchApril In ParisInch); plus one apiece by Radiohead (InchGlass EyesInch) and Lo Borges (InchClube Da Esquina M.1Inch).
